    Rellich-type Discrete Compactness for Some Discontinuous Galerkin FEM

    Get PDF
    We deduce discrete compactness of Rellich type for some discontinuous Galerkin finite element methods (DGFEM) including hybrid ones, under fairly general settings on the triangulations and the finite element spaces. We make use of regularity of the solutions to an auxiliary second-order elliptic boundary value problem as well as the error estimates of the associated finite element solutions. The present results can be used for analyzing DGFEM applied to some boundary value and eigenvalue problems, and also to derive the discrete PoincarĀ“e-Friedrichs inequalities.discontinuous Galerkin FEM, polygonal element, discrete compactness, Rellichā€™s selection theorem
